You are all such driven kids and so hard working…but, you overstress. When you get to campus, find out which profs are involved with research and find out what classes they teach. Develop a relationship with said profs…alternatively, find out thier office hours and simply go in and see them and ask to get involved. Don’t overestimate how difficult this will be. They teach and research and they WANT you to come and get involved. I promise if you want to research and if you are bold and open and unafraid to be the one who goes to speak to them, they will involve you. Otherwise they’d be working in the private sector. They want to work with students who want to work with them! I promise.</p>
